Output ff6cac6419fdfa6f65ace9ae3999244ed808173ce75505ea974f67360ae1de0d:59

value
52407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bd9fa8c03c3846e391b37b00b8b44b16b55201 OP_EQUAL
address
37mugVG27Fj6o7E8ycvPHPK1NtAbjCnjhh
transaction
ff6cac6419fdfa6f65ace9ae3999244ed808173ce75505ea974f67360ae1de0d
spent
true